This gorge, which is ideal for hiking, can only be reached on foot. Hiking trips must be made dependent on the water level. In spring and autumn, the Aiguillon usually turns into a raging river, while the riverbed is usually dry in summer. Visitors should also avoid walking through the gorge when it is raining. The reason: the water rises very quickly.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ural wonders can I explore around Tharaux?

The region around Tharaux is rich in natural beauty. You can visit Les Concluses Viewpoint, a stunning gorge where the riverbed often dries up in summer, allowing for unique exploration. Another remarkable spot is The Little Aiguières, an idyllic gorge with turquoise waters and natural swimming pools. Further afield, the renowned Aven d'Orgnac Cave, a Grand Site of France, offers an impressive underground experience. The dramatic Gorges de l'Ardèche and the iconic Pont d'Arc are also within reach.

Are there any charming historical villages to visit near Tharaux?

Yes, several picturesque villages with rich history are close by. Montclus is a well-preserved medieval settlement situated on a loop of the Cèze River, featuring a picturesque bridge. Other notable villages include Barjac, known for its Friday market, Goudargues with its canal, and Cornillon, a hilltop village with an interesting historic center. La Roque-sur-Cèze, recognized as one of France's "Most Beautiful Villages," offers charming steep streets to explore.

When is the best time to visit the natural gorges and riverbeds?

For attractions like Les Concluses Viewpoint, the summer months, typically from mid-June, are ideal. During this period, the riverbed often dries up, allowing visitors to walk and scramble upstream, offering a unique perspective of the gorge. However, for lush waterfalls and flowing rivers, visiting outside the peak summer, especially after rainfall, would be more suitable.

Are there opportunities for wild swimming near Tharaux?

Yes, the region offers several spots for refreshing wild swimming. The Little Aiguières is particularly noted for its clear, cold water and natural swimming pools within the Séguissous gorge. The Cèze River, which flows at the foot of Tharaux, also provides pleasant spots for a dip, as do various locations along the Gorges de l'Ardèche.

Are there any Roman historical sites accessible from Tharaux?

Yes, the region is home to one of France's most iconic Roman structures. The Pont du Gard, an ancient Roman aqueduct and a UNESCO World Heritage site, is located approximately 37 km from Tharaux. It's a magnificent example of Roman engineering and a must-see historical landmark.

Can I find local markets near Tharaux to experience local life?

Absolutely. Several nearby towns host vibrant local markets. Barjac has a market on Fridays, while Goudargues hosts one on Wednesdays. Other towns like Saint-Ambroix, Saint-Paul-le-Jeune, Bessèges, Vallon Pont d'Arc, and Alès also offer markets where you can find local produce and experience the regional atmosphere.
